How this pilot differs

There are certain items the Greenwich Composting Project cannot compost at our site. These items include dairy, meat, bones, left over food with dairy, meat or oils.  We are asking our participating households to segregate these for a twice a month pickup when we weigh the waste and take it to Holly Hill. Holly Hill have the necessary resources to compost these materials.

How it works

  1. Segregate the items on the list below and store them separately from your other kitchen scraps
    1. Meat
    2. Bones
    3. Dairy
    4. Left over meals
    5. Rice
    6. Cake
    7. Fish
  2. Store them ready for pick up. We suggest storing in freezer to reduce unpleasant odors!
  3. On pick up day leave in an accessible spot outside.
